E-P-S

Anmeldungsdatum: 16.09.2004 Beiträge: 500 Wohnort: Neuruppin
|
Verfasst am: 01.04.2009, 09:29 Titel: Wie erstellt man ein 'Label' |
|
|
Hi zusammen,
ich tue mich grad etwas schwer mit der Erstellung eines simplen Labels - also eines Elements das Text anzeigt, diesen ausrichten kann und einen Rahmen haben kann.
Bei den Beispielen die ich so finde wird ein STATIC Control dazu hergenommen, welches auch Rahmen hat und Text anzeigt - 2 von 3, schonmal gut.
Bei der Textausrichtung haperts dann aber. Wenn ich in Visuellen Editoren (bsp: Delphi) ein Label erstelle, kann ich den Text darin Links, Rechts und zentriert ausrichten und dies sowohl horizontal als auch vertikal.
Horizontal bekomme ich auch noch hin im STATIC - per SS_LEFT, SS_CENTER und SS_RIGHT. Aber vertikal geht so gar nicht.
BS_CENTER richtet den Text zwar vertikal zentriert aus, dabei geht jedoch der Zeilenumbruch verloren und an den unteren Rand bekomme ich den Text gar nicht.
So, langer Text, nun zur Frage:
1. Ist das STATIC Control dafür das richtige? Wenn nicht, welches dann?
2. Wie richte ich Text aus, in allen Richtungen
3. Wie funktioniert die AUsrichung auch MIT MultiLine, WordWrap etc.
4. Kann man text auch inherit ausgeben (Blocksatz)
phuh...viele Fragen und ich hoffe jemand kann helfen - vielen, vielen Dank _________________ Man kann sich öfter als zweimal im Leben halb tot lachen. |
|